Dimethylethanolamine (DMAE or DMEA) is an organic compound with the formula Page Module:Chem2/styles.css has no content.(CH3)2NCH2CH2OH. It is bifunctional, containing both a tertiary amine and primary alcohol functional groups. It is a colorless viscous liquid. It is used in skin care products for improving skin tone and also taken orally as a nootropic. It is prepared by the ethoxylation of dimethylamine.[2]
Industrial uses
Dimethylaminoethanol is used as a curing agent for polyurethanes and epoxy resins. It is a precursor to other chemicals, such as the nitrogen mustard 2-dimethylaminoethyl chloride.[3] The acrylate ester, dimethylaminoethyl acrylate is used as a flocculating agent.[4]
Related compounds are used in gas purification, e.g. removal of hydrogen sulfide from sour gas streams.
Human uses
The bitartrate salt of DMAE, i.e. N,N-dimethylethanolamine bitartrate, is sold as a dietary supplement.[5] It is a white powder providing 37% DMAE.[6]
Animal tests show possible benefit for improving spatial memory[7] and working memory.[8]
